Sweet???? Might be sweet now but it's gonna be stupid later.

How to put on a helmet when you are old:

1. Take off glasses
2. Put someplace they won't fall and break. I learned that the hard way.
3. Turn off and disconnect your custom sound system.
4. Put carefully put in case, learned the hard way.
5. Put carefully put case in zippered pocket, learned the hard way.
6. Put on helmet
7. Put on glasses.

When somebody old wants to talk about your RZR reverse process. He might wait. When somebody that isn't too old wants wants to talk about your RZR nod head and wave. He'll likely leave before you get it done and you will just have to start over.

I'll bet my custom sound system costs a heck of alot more than his. I've got 7K in mine. If it's too loud...you are too old was written by someone with nothing to stop the music from going in one ear and out the other. Besides when you are too old not only are things rarely too loud but when they are....your ears have off switches.

I've been in the music and entertainment business for 35 years. I couldn't turn it down but I sure wish I had worn a cheap set of ear plugs. What? I cant hear ya is pretty damn funny until what you can't hear is your grandkids.
